publisher: University Of Toronto Press publish date: 2002
format: paperback pages: 664
language: English
ISBN:
1551113198 (9781551113197)
publisher: University Of Toronto Press publish date: March 1st 2006
format: paperback pages: 668
language: English
ISBN:
1551117797 (9781551117799)